| Degenerate Craft Fair – Brooklyn, NY Posted: 28 Nov 2012 11:29 PM PST If you’re in the market for a different kind of craft market, the degenerate craft fair might be the place for you. Started and run by artists, the focus here is on erasing lines between art and craft, allowing for a variety of handmade goods. For the fourth year of the fair, there are over 50 artists exhibiting and selling … |

SharonB of Pin Tangle has opened registration for her first couple of online classes for next year: Encrusted Crazy Quilting (starting February 13) and Sumptuous Surface Embroidery (starting March 7). Sharon is known for presenting interesting, thorough instruction in a supportive environment, so her classes fill quickly. If you would like to learn from the master of encrustation,
